As of July, 23, 2026, the average designer print gross salary in Kuala Lumpur, Malaysia is RM80,629 or an equivalent hourly rate of RM32. In addition, designer prints earn an average bonus of RM2,620. An entry level designer print with 1-3 years of experience earns an average salary of RM58,460. At the higher end of the pay range, a senior level designer print with 8+ years of experience earns an average salary of RM92,079. Salary estimates are based on salary survey data collected directly from employers in Kuala Lumpur, Malaysia.

What does a Designer Print do?
Develops high-quality print materials that align with brand standards and project specifications. Designs layouts for brochures, posters, packaging, trade show displays, and other printed collateral. Readies files for prepress and production, ensuring color accuracy, print resolution, and formatting consistency. Collaborates with marketing, communications, and product teams to understand project goals and messaging requirements. Manages multiple design projects simultaneously, adhering to deadlines and maintaining quality across deliverables.
